Sinner Number One

Paul, the apostle, helped to write this song. He called himself the ‘greatest of sinners’… Sinner

Number One.  1 Timothy 1:15-16 But Paul was certain, as we can be certain, that Jesus loves us

all, whoever we are, whatever we’ve done.
